On the evening of August 28th at 9 o'clock, the website of the Central Commission for Discipline Inspection and the National Supervisory Commission released a heavyweight news: Recently, Sun Zhigang, former secretary of the Guizhou Provincial Party Committee, was suspected of serious violations of discipline and law and was under disciplinary review and supervision investigation by the Central Commission for Discipline Inspection and the National Supervisory Commission.

Sun Zhigang became the second ministerial level cadre to be investigated this year after Dong Yunhu, and also the first former provincial party and government "leader" to be arrested after the 20th National Congress of the Communist Party of China.

Sun Zhigang was born in May 1954 in Xingyang, Henan Province, with a PhD in Economics. Formerly served as a member of the 19th Central Committee and Vice Chairman of the Finance and Economic Committee of the 13th National People's Congress.

In his early years, Sun Zhigang was a volunteer educated youth in Xingyang County, Henan Province. Later, he became a reservoir cadre and studied steelmaking at the Metallurgical Department of Wuhan Iron and Steel University from 1973 to 1976. Later, he stayed on as a teacher. From 1980 to 1983, I pursued a master's degree in Industrial Economics at Shanghai University of Finance and Economics. After graduation, I went to work at the Institute of Economics at Central South University of Finance and Economics. Since 1985, Sun Zhigang has held various positions including Deputy Director of the Wuhan Municipal Economic Commission, Deputy Director of the Wuhan Municipal Commission for Economic Reform, Deputy Director of the Wuhan Municipal Planning Commission, Deputy Secretary, Deputy District Chief, Acting District Chief, District Chief of Hanyang District, Deputy Mayor of Wuhan, Deputy Secretary and Mayor of Yichang Municipal Party Committee, Secretary of Yichang Municipal Party Committee, Chairman of the Standing Committee of the Municipal People's Congress, and First Secretary of the Party Committee of Yichang Military District.

In 2002, Sun Zhigang joined the Standing Committee of the Hubei Provincial Party Committee and was promoted to the deputy ministerial level. He also served as the Secretary General of the Provincial Party Committee and the Secretary of the Provincial Government Working Committee. In 2006, he was transferred to Anhui as a member of the Standing Committee of the Provincial Party Committee and Executive Vice Governor. Four years later, he transferred to Beijing and served as Deputy Director of the National Development and Reform Commission and Director of the State Council Medical Reform Office. In 2013, Sun Zhigang was appointed as the Deputy Director of the National Health and Family Planning Commission and the Director of the State Council Medical Reform Office, and was promoted to the ministerial level.

In October 2015, Sun Zhigang went to Guizhou to serve as the Deputy Secretary of the Guizhou Provincial Party Committee, Deputy Governor, Acting Governor, and Secretary of the Provincial Government Party Group. The following year, he became the Governor of Guizhou Province. In 2017, he became the Secretary of the Guizhou Provincial Party Committee and stepped down in November 2020. He served as the Vice Chairman of the Finance and Economic Committee of the 13th National People's Congress in December 2020 and stepped down in March of this year.

Sun Zhigang was the third provincial and ministerial level leading cadre to fall from grace in Guizhou Province after the closing of the 20th National Congress of the Communist Party of China. On November 27th last year, Zhou Jiankun, Vice Chairman of the Guizhou Provincial Political Consultative Conference, was investigated. On March 27th this year, Li Zaiyong, Vice Chairman of the Guizhou Provincial Political Consultative Conference, was investigated. Sun Zhigang is also the second official at the ministerial level to fall from power in Guizhou Province since the 19th National Congress of the Communist Party of China. In February 2021, Wang Fuyu, former chairman of the Guizhou Provincial Committee of the Chinese People's Political Consultative Conference, was investigated. Sun Zhigang has worked together with the aforementioned individuals.

How was the Shanghai lawyer appointed to defend the Gang of Four On August 16th, the Municipal Bureau of Justice organized a government open day event called "Entering the Shanghai Judicial Administration History Exhibition Room". More than 40 public representatives visited the Shanghai Judicial Administration History Exhibition Hall to gain a deep understanding of the past, present, and future of Shanghai's judicial administration. The exhibition room has 9 exhibition halls, including the Comprehensive Rule of Law Hall, the Administrative and Legislative Hall, the Public Legal Service Hall, and the Outlook for the Future Hall. There are nearly 1800 historical materials, 79 videos, and 34 interactive projects, including photos, documents, and other physical objects, showcasing the historical development of Shanghai's judicial administration in all aspects

In recent years, short video live streaming platforms have developed rapidly. According to reports from relevant research institutions, the user base of online live streaming in China has exceeded 700 million people. Under the huge market dividend, many anchors have abundant income, which has also stimulated more young people to enter the anchor industry. Xiaoyu, who is still in college, is one of them. In August 2020, he signed an exclusive entertainment agency contract with a cultural company in Shanghai, despite his handsome appearance. However, four months later, due to frequent conflicts between the company's arranged live broadcast time and school courses, the two sides continued to experience friction. Xiaoyu had the idea of terminating the contract, and the company proposed a penalty of 9 million yuan for breach of contract. Xiaoyu's experience is not an exception. According to a review of public reports by Jiefang Daily's Shangguan News, many companies will stipulate high liquidated damages in their contracts when signing contracts with anchors.

At 16:12 on July 21, Shanghai center Meteorological Observatory updated rainstorm blue as rainstorm yellow warning signal. Entering the evening peak, the rain continued and urban road traffic was affected. The reporter learned from the Municipal Public Security Traffic Police Corps that some sections of the city's Pudong, Yangpu, Putuo and other areas have experienced waterlogging, and the slow traffic of vehicles on the Central Ring Road is prominent, significantly affecting road traffic. The traffic police departments in the city have increased their police force and carried out dynamic monitoring of water prone points such as underpasses. Together with the departments of obstacle clearance, maintenance, and water management, they will promptly carry out drainage and disposal. In sections with severe waterlogging, on-site traffic police will also guide people and vehicles to detour according to the plan. The traffic police department reminds the general public to slow down the speed, use lights according to regulations, drive with caution, and avoid danger when driving after work.

After more than 10 months of being prosecuted by the procuratorial organs, Gong Jianhua, former member of the Party Group and Deputy Director of the Standing Committee of the Jiangxi Provincial People's Congress, appeared in court for trial. On June 15th, the Intermediate People's Court of Zhangzhou City, Fujian Province, publicly held a first instance trial of Gong Jianhua's bribery case. Gong Jianhua pleaded guilty and repented in court, and the court announced a date for sentencing. Gong Jianhua was born in 1962 in Nanchang County, Jiangxi Province. He has been working in Jiangxi for nearly 40 years and has served in various places such as the Jiangxi Provincial Agriculture Office, Nanchang, Yichun, and Fuzhou. He has held positions such as Deputy Secretary of the Nanchang Municipal Party Committee, Mayor of Yichun, and Secretary of the Fuzhou Municipal Party Committee. In 2014, he was appointed as a member of the Standing Committee of the Provincial Party Committee and was promoted to the deputy ministerial level. The following year, he was appointed as the Secretary of the Nanchang Municipal Party Committee. In 2017, he was appointed as the Deputy Director of the Standing Committee of the Provincial People's Congress, and he voluntarily submitted to the case in 2021.
